Traffic sensors in Antigua and Barbuda are instrumental in collecting real-time data on vehicle movements, traffic flow, and road conditions to support traffic management and urban planning efforts. Deployed in smart intersections, highways, and urban areas, traffic sensors provide valuable insights for optimizing traffic signals, improving road safety, and reducing congestion. With advancements in sensor technology and data analytics, the traffic sensor market is evolving, enabling cities to achieve more efficient and sustainable transportation systems.
The traffic sensor market in Antigua and Barbuda is driven by the adoption of IoT technology and smart transportation solutions. Key drivers include the demand for real-time traffic data collection, congestion management, and intelligent transportation systems.
The traffic sensor market in Antigua and Barbuda encounters challenges such as technological complexity and integration with existing infrastructure. Developing sensors that accurately detect vehicle movements and traffic patterns requires advanced sensor technologies and data analytics capabilities. Market demand fluctuates with urbanization trends and smart city initiatives, posing challenges in scalability and customization of sensor solutions. Moreover, regulatory compliance with data privacy laws and interoperability standards requires adherence to stringent guidelines, impacting product development timelines and market entry strategies.
The government of Antigua and Barbuda supports the traffic sensor market with policies that promote data-driven decision-making, regulatory frameworks for traffic monitoring, and infrastructure development. Initiatives focus on improving transportation efficiency, safety, and environmental sustainability.
